Transaction 506fc698a5f712c905b82cd1acfeb1356f108cb67eb2710956457d8c83634c11
1 Input
2 Outputs
- 506fc698a5f712c905b82cd1acfeb1356f108cb67eb2710956457d8c83634c11:0
- 506fc698a5f712c905b82cd1acfeb1356f108cb67eb2710956457d8c83634c11:1
value 653819
address 3MP6ZDuoqnGnN4GMmbGmf1a1yKuttC1hZn
value 650932
address 16SCJboDsAr4meLJ2XBCHKQiDRRMMAN3fz